<script>
var asfman = {};
asfman.urlEncode = function(str)
{
window.execScript("Function vbsFun(str):vbsFun=hex(asc(str)):End Function","vbscript");
var gObject={};
return str.replace(/[\x00-\xff]/g,function(a)
{
return a.replace(/[^0-9a-zA-Z]/g,function(b){
if(!gObject[b])
gObject[b]="%"+vbsFun(b);
return gObject[b];
})
}).replace(/[^\x00-\xff]/g,function(c){
return c.replace(/./g,function(d)
{
if(!gObject[d])
gObject[d]= vbsFun(d).replace(/(..)(..)/,"%$1%$2");
return gObject[d];
})
}).replace(/%20/g,"+")
};
alert(asfman.urlEncode("你好"));
</script>
在项目中有个地方必须用JS进行GBK编码,在网上找了一段,IE8测试通过,FF不行
以后还是用UTF-8编码吧,嗨~
分享到:
相关推荐
GBKCode是款非常不错的汉字编码查询软件,这软件的...GBKCode:反查汉字编码软件中文版支持反查GBK汉字编码,或逐区显示GBK汉字(gbk编码查询)。GBK汉字包括所有GB2312、Big5、CJK汉字。 开始是为了对比JavaScript对
js 中文gbk编码,纯代码实现 ** 类名:J.gbk ** 版本:1.0 ** 功能:URLEncode,URLDecode ** 示例: --------------------------------------------------------------------------------------------------- ...
纯js对字符串进行gb2312编码解码,如“中国”编码后成为:“%D6%D0%B9%FA”,很好用的
本文提供了一个javascript的unicode与GBK2312编码相互转换的方法,大家可以参考使用,实用的小实例
个是就是把汉字和Unicode编码互转的javascript代码,也是从网上找到了,也许有人用得着!!
在网上找到一个GBK拼音编码表,关于JS这方面的东西网上有很多. 但是支持的字符不多,这个拼音编码表具说支持GBK字符,我刚整出来 还没应用到实际中,弄了几个生辟字查询了一下都可以找到
UTF-8匹配: 在javascript中,要判断字符串是中文是很简单的,下面有个不错的判断示例,需要的朋友可以参考下
起因 一个几个月前做的小网站,这两天翻出来再看看,发现JavaScript文件中动态添加html元素中的中文乱码了,...多次尝试无果,我就抱着多试一次也没啥的态度,把JavaScript文件的编码格式改为了GBK,然后运行项目 居
网上只能找到tinyeditor的英文版本,对于国内用户还是不太方便,自己动手汉化了一下,并且将编码改成了gbk,希望可以帮助有需要的朋友。 下面是关于tinyeditor的介绍(摘自网络): 前几日曾给大家介绍过一款国产...
主要介绍了php与javascript正则匹配中文的方法,结合实例形式分析了针对utf-8与GBK编码情况下的php、javascript正则匹配中文操作技巧,需要的朋友可以参考下
RESPONSETEXT里面的中文多半会出现乱码,这是因为xmlhttp在处理返回的responseText的时候,是把 resposeBody按UTF-8编码进解码考形成的,如果服务器送出的确实是UTF-8的数据流的时候汉字会正确显示,而送出了GBK编码...
3. css文件中含有中文时,如果css编码和页面编码不一致,需要手动将中文替换为\xxxx, 详细说明请参考compressor.cmd中的说明 4. 如果不需要native2ascii, 可以只安装JRE即可(需要手动修改下compressor.cmd) Ref: ...
我的第一个Servlet程序: Servlet是Server Applet 服务器端小java程序 每一个Servlet必须实现Servlet规范中的核心...而包含中文字符的代码一般是UNICODE格式,所以直接运行含有中文字符的代码就很容易出现编码错误。
包括Unicode(UTF-8、UTF-16/32)、Big5、GBK以及S-JIS 支持Unicode CJK 扩展B区(Ext-B) 可进行中文繁、简体的转换 若用户输入的字符不为当前编码支持,该字符会被转换成诸如U+XXXX的Unicode格式可用正则表达式进行...
codepage属性:是指出网页的代码页 如果制作的网页脚本与WEB服务端的默认代码页不同,则必须指明代码页: 代码如下: codepage=936 简体中文GBK codepage=950 繁体中文BIG5 codepage=437 美国/加拿大英语 codepage=...
按语言划分的主要非UTF8编码: 朝鲜语:cp949,euc-kr 日语:sjis(shift_jis),cp932,euc-jp 中文:gbk,gb18030,gb2312,cp936,hkscs,big5,cp950安装npm install -g unzip-mbcs命令行界面Usage: unzip-mbcs...
主要介绍了python解决js文件utf-8编码乱码问题,非常不错,具有参考借鉴价值,需要的朋友可以参考下
3.2.7 使用函数进行数据类型的强制 3.2.7 转换 57 3.3 小结 57 第4章 函数处理与数据引用 58 4.1 函数的定义与使用 58 4.1.1 函数的调用 58 4.1.2 用户自定义函数的编写 58 4.2 PHP常用函数 59 4.2.1 获得日期时间...